SafeNote is a free and open source note taking app for Windows. It allows securely storing notes, ideas, passwords and more with AES-256 encryption. Useful for taking quick notes or saving sensitive information.
TeleGuard is a call center software designed for small to medium sized businesses. It provides features like automatic call distribution, call recording, real-time monitoring, reporting, and integrations with CRM and help desk software.
